FFA is in need of a tenacious Certified Nurse Practitioner responsible for administering non-invasive services such as injectables and micro needling. This role will be based in our Blue Ash, OH. office, but will need to be available for occasional travel and support to multiple offices. Travel would be between Pennsylvania, Ohio, Indiana and Nevada throughout the business.
Travel constitutes 25% of the position.
This position will be a challenging and exciting role as it is a position that allows for significant autonomy, empowerment to innovate and make a meaningful impact on operations, as well as provide best in class guest experience. Our provider will report to a regional manager and have a support staff including but not limited to our heavily experienced trainer, clinical lead, all the way to the support of our owners.
We are looking for a highly tenacious, professional, nurse practitioner with a passion for aesthetics and the desire to work for an exciting, always evolving, expanding company.
Responsibilities
Perform aesthetic procedures that include, but not limited to neurotoxins, fillers, and micro needling in accordance with established treatment protocols, scope of practice, organizational policies & procedures, and all other governing standards.

FFA was founded because we believe everyone should have the ability to own their look.
Face Forward Aesthetics is a multimodal aesthetic medicine practice with locations in Columbus, Cleveland, Cincinnati, Dayton, Pittsburgh, Indianapolis, Toledo and Las Vegas.
We specialize in injectables, combining science and art to enhance our patient’s natural beauty. We have made it our mission to operate the safest practices possible, remaining conservative in our methods, and see ourselves as a market disrupter by concentrating on providing the highest quality service at the lowest prices.
